End of Song stays on page
#1
I disabled "Debounce". For me that works best because I can quickly get to the first or last page of the song by holding down the pedal (maybe because I got used to the billipro pedal before switching to the Ciceda).

Anyway, it seems like now that I disabled debounce, once I get the "end of the song" message (or "start of the song" message), it does not go away (even if I turn the page).

Although the message is nice (as long as it fades away pretty quickly), I would be okay just disabling the message (I pretty much always know if I am on the 1st or last page of the last page fo the song).

[Actually its a bit more nuanced than this. Sometimes it stays on (especially if I don't turn the page). Sometimes even if I turn the page, the message stays. But sometimes it goes away after I turn the page. But something seems not quite right as to the start of page and end of page messages when debounce is disabled]

#2
I will have to test this out, but it's very possible that if you are holding down the pedal that it generates a "End of Song" message a large number of times, which would explain why it appears to stay on. I'll have to think about how I want to handle this.. I will probably just put some code in there to watch the time since the last page turn, and if the time is too short, i won't generate the message (indicating that someone is repeatedly attempting to turn past the end of the song). As a side note, I'm also planning on adding easy ways to get to the start/end of songs and the start/end of setlists.
